Introduction: With the rise in popularity of blockchain games, the need for enhanced cybersecurity within this community has become more critical than ever. Blockchain technology provides unique opportunities for gaming, but it also exposes players to various threats, such as hacking, data breaches, and scams. In this article, we will explore the importance of cybersecurity in the blockchain games community and discuss measures that can be implemented to safeguard players and their assets. 1. Understanding the Vulnerabilities: The decentralized nature of blockchain games brings both advantages and challenges. While it eliminates the need for intermediaries and provides transparency, it also creates a potential attack surface for cybercriminals. Smart contracts, user wallets, and decentralized marketplaces are some of the areas vulnerable to exploitation. It's crucial for gamers to be aware of these vulnerabilities to stay ahead of potential threats. 2. Secure Wallet Management: Proper wallet management is essential for players participating in blockchain games. A secure wallet acts as a vault to protect a user's digital assets. Users should choose reputable wallet providers and apply secure practices, such as using strong passwords, enabling two-factor authentication, and keeping wallet software up to date. It's also advisable to hold only the necessary funds in gaming wallets and utilize hardware wallets for additional security. 3. Educating the Community: A well-informed community is more resilient against cyber threats. Educating players about basic cybersecurity practices can minimize the risk of falling victim to scams or phishing attempts. Blockchain game developers should contribute by providing resources and guidelines on secure gaming practices, emphasizing the importance of password hygiene, avoiding suspicious links, and recognizing potential malicious activities. 4. Auditing Smart Contracts: Smart contracts serve as an integral part of many blockchain games, facilitating various in-game activities. Conducting thorough audits of smart contracts helps identify potential vulnerabilities and ensures their security and reliability. Engaging third-party auditors who specialize in smart contract security can provide an extra layer of trust for players. 5. Implementing Multi-factor Authentication: Adding an additional layer of security through multi-factor authentication (MFA) can significantly enhance cybersecurity in the blockchain games community. By requiring users to provide more than just a password, MFA helps combat unauthorized account access. Implementing MFA can be achieved through various methods, including SMS codes, authenticator apps, or hardware tokens. 6. Collaborating with Security Experts: Blockchain game developers should actively collaborate with cybersecurity experts to address potential threats and challenges. By seeking the expertise of professionals well-versed in blockchain security, developers can better understand emerging risks, fortify their platforms, and create a safer gaming environment for the community. Regular security audits and continuous updates should be part of a developer's strategy to keep pace with evolving cybersecurity threats.
